Family tree of Spijk and her many ancestors » Ingetje Pieters Spanjersbergh . / Spanjenberg (1730-1793)

Personal data Ingetje Pieters Spanjersbergh . / Spanjenberg 


Household of Ingetje Pieters Spanjersbergh . / Spanjenberg

She is married to Pieter Kornelisz van der Spijck.

They got married on May 26, 1758 at Vlaardingen, ZH, NL.Sources 3, 4


Child(ren):


Event (huw info): Pieter Van Spijk J.M. ende Ingetje Spanjersberg J.D. beide wonende alhier.Source 4

Event (kinderen) on May 12, 1758 in Vlaardingen, ZH, NL .Source 5
